The Science Behind Strength Training and Muscle Growth

Strength training, characterized by exercises that challenge the muscles against resistance, triggers a cascade of physiological adaptations within the body. The primary mechanism responsible for muscle growth is a process known as hypertrophy, where muscle fibers increase in size and number. This occurs due to the microscopic tears that occur in muscle fibers during strenuous exercise. In response to these tears, the body initiates a repair process, leading to the synthesis of new muscle proteins and the growth of existing fibers. This process is further enhanced by the release of anabolic hormones, such as testosterone and growth hormone, which stimulate muscle protein synthesis.

The Benefits of Strength Training for Lower Limb Strength

The benefits of strength training extend beyond increased muscle mass, particularly for the lower limbs. Studies have consistently demonstrated that strength training programs effectively enhance lower limb strength in university students. This improvement is attributed to the increased muscle mass and the enhanced neuromuscular efficiency that results from strength training. The nervous system becomes more adept at recruiting and activating muscle fibers, leading to more powerful contractions. This translates to improved performance in activities that rely heavily on lower limb strength, such as running, jumping, and lifting heavy objects.
